My new power outfit
The instructions of how to choose the size and how much to take length from the pattern pieces were very clear and easy to apply. In my case, my fitting toile seemed ok, but after I had assembled most of the jumpsuit in the fashion fabric, it was inevitable that I needed to make adjustments with the lower part of the jumpsuit. The weight of my fashion fabric was in the upper end of the suggested spectrum, which caused a sense of excess fabric bunching around the zip fly area, especially when sitting. Instead of ripping every seam and topstitching below the waist (including the waistband and zip fly) and cutting the facings, I decided to to see if I could reduce the length of lower front by opening the crotch seam and take some length in from the crotch. I managed to lift the crotch seam by approx 3 cm, which turned out well.
Other than this mishap with my weightier fabric, the design and the instructions were very good. This was my first time making this kind of facing, and it turned out very nice with the help of the instructions and illustration. I chose not to do the chest welt pocket as I feared it would not look great (I don’t have good experiences of welt pockets in RTW garments because they seem to be all over the place after washing.) I could’ve used a bit more handholding for making the zip fly look good on the inside too. I used the bias binding for the zip, but it didn’t turn out neat.
I feel this garment will be my “power outfit”. It looks and feels good to wear, and I’m glad I managed to sew the topstitching and other visible details with attention. Im sure I’ll sew this jumpsuit pattern again in the future, with a lighter fabric.
